Job Description
About Us
cogify group is a Swiss technology company providing software development, IT consulting, and digital transformation solutions across multiple industries. Our expertise spans agile consulting, enterprise software, ERP solutions, and NFC/RFID-powered business tools.
Our key divisions:
Requirements
Responsibilities
cogify group is a Swiss technology company providing software development, IT consulting, and digital transformation solutions across multiple industries. Our expertise spans agile consulting, enterprise software, ERP solutions, and NFC/RFID-powered business tools.
Our key divisions:
- cogify.io - Custom software development and full-scale digital transformation
- inPositiv - Agile IT consulting, SAP implementation, and enterprise IT strategy
- Arrakis - Industry 4.0 & SAP solutions, automation, and enterprise software for industrial sectors
- Organitz - A modular ERP system for SMEs, streamlining CRM, time tracking, project management, invoicing.
- iCards - NFC & RFID-powered business networking, enabling instant contact exchange, CRM integration, and engagement tracking. iCards showcase our expertise in RFID and automation technologies for digital business solutions
Requirements
Responsibilities
- Design, develop, and maintain backend services using Spring Boot (Java)
- Build and optimize APIs for mobile applications (iOS & Android)
- Develop and maintain frontend applications using modern frameworks (React + Typescript)
- Collaborate with mobile engineers and UI/UX designers to integrate backend and frontend components seamlessly
- Ensure scalability, security, and performance of full-stack applications
- Deliver high-quality production and test code, conduct code-reviews and write helpful documentation
- Work with cross-functional teams to define and deliver new features
- Troubleshoot and debug production issues efficiently
- Stay updated with the latest trends and technologies in full-stack development
- 5+ years of experience in software engineering, with a focus on Spring Boot (Java) and frontend frameworks
- Strong experience in developing and maintaining RESTful APIs and/or GraphQL
- Proficiency with databases, both relational (e.g. PostgreSQL) and document-oriented such as MongoDB
- Hands-on experience with front-end technologies (React + Typescript)
- Experience working with cloud platforms (Azure)
- Knowledge of containerization and orchestration tools like Docker and Kubernetes
- Understanding of microservices architecture and event-driven systems
- Strong problem-solving skills and the ability to work in a fast-paced environment
- Excellent communication and teamwork skills
- Residency in the EU/EFTA is required
- Experience with Next.js framework
- Angular to develop and maintain frontend applications using modern frameworks
- Familiarity with Keycloak as a solution for access management
- Knowledge of Agile/Scrum methodologies
- Join a Swiss-based tech leader in software, IT consulting, and digital transformation
- Work with top professionals in an international, innovation-driven environment
- Fully remote with a structured workload - Our 150-hour/month freelance model ensures a balanced workload, factoring in public holidays and personal time, unlike standard 180-hour contracts
- Competitive compensation with a structured freelance contract, offering both stability and flexibility